Recent polling in the lead-up to South Korea's June 3 local elections shows Democratic Party candidate Chun Jae-soo holding a lead over incumbent People Power Party mayor Park Heong-joon in Busan, the country's second-largest city. Traders have priced this momentum into the market, reflecting assessments of voter sentiment in a race marked by competing platforms on maritime development and local welfare. Televised debates and campaign events have highlighted contrasts in records and proposals, while national party figures have campaigned on the ground. Minor candidates remain on the ballot but show negligible support in surveys, consistent with the two-party dominance typical in South Korean mayoral contests.
